Well & Pump Repair: Common Problems, Causes & Warning Signs in Stillwater, MN
Being aware of warning signs in well and pump systems can prevent serious issues. Look for fluctuating water pressure, discolored water, or strange noises coming from the pump. These symptoms might indicate underlying problems, often exacerbated in older properties. An evaluation can help pinpoint issues before they escalate, ensuring reliable water supply.
Well & Pump Repair Evaluation Details
- Fluctuating water pressure
- Unusual sounds from the pump
- Discolored water
- Frequent cycling of the pump

Common Questions About Well & Pump Repair
The following FAQs clarify common questions regarding well and pump repair services.
What are common signs of pump failure?
Signs of pump failure may include inconsistent water pressure, unusual noises, or water discoloration. Addressing these symptoms early can help prevent more extensive repairs.
How often should my well be inspected?
Regular well inspections are recommended at least once a year or if any symptoms arise. This ensures the longevity and reliability of your water supply.
Can I repair my well pump myself?
While some minor adjustments can be made, it’s advisable to consult with a professional for safety and proper diagnosis to avoid worsening any issues.
What factors affect my water well’s lifespan?
Factors like geological conditions, pump maintenance, and water quality play significant roles in the lifespan of your water well.
How do I know if my pressure tank needs replacement?
Signs your tank may need replacement include frequent cycling or inadequate water pressure, impacting overall system efficiency.
What is the typical timeline for well repairs?
Repair timelines vary depending on the issue, but most repairs can be completed within a few hours to a day, depending on complexity.
